Which of the following statements are not correct?A. Hydrogen is used to reduce heavy metal oxides to metals.B. Heavy water is used to study reaction mechanism.C. Hydrogen is used to make saturated fats from oils.D. The bond dissociation enthalpy is lowest as compared to a single bond between two atoms of any elements.E. Hydrogen reduces oxides of metals that are more active than iron.Choose the correct answer:

  1. A
    B, D only
  2. B
    D, E only
  3. C
    A, B, C only
  4. D
    B, C, D, E only

Solution & Step-by-step Explanation

1. A, B, and C are correct uses/properties of hydrogen/heavy water.2. Statement D is incorrect: The bond has a very high dissociation enthalpy () for a single bond, which is why it is relatively unreactive at room temperature.3. Statement E is incorrect: Hydrogen can only reduce oxides of metals that are less active than it in the reactivity series (like ). It cannot reduce oxides of very active metals like or .Incorrect statements are D and E.
